Descrption: Genie Backup Manager Professional Edition 7.0 adds more functions to extend flexibility and features beside the functions provided by Genie Backup Manager Home Edition, such as: Alternative Data Stream Preservation, Pre & Post Commands, Job Cloning, Multi-Drive Spanning, Manually enter file/folder path, CD/DVD simulation, Outlook/Outlook Express auto close, Support Genie Run Script and etc.
Genie Backup Manager Professional Edition can work with File Access Manager (FAM) as well and offer three add-ons software: Genie Eyes-only, Genie Log View and Genie Wipe.

How to Use File Access Manager Add a Backup Software to File Access Manager File Access Manager can work with ALL Windows based backup software applications to provide you with a COMPLETE data protection solution. To add a backup software to the list: 1-Select “Allowed Programs”, 2-Select “Add” 3-Browse to the backup software .EXE and click “open” 4-You will now see that .EXE in the list of “Allowed Programs” .
Allowed programs By selecting this option, you will have the option to add an application so that it may have access to ALL exclusive, in use or open file(s). This application is usually a backup software.
Set General Preferences Show in system Tray: This will allow you to choose whether or not to show the File Access Manager icon in the system tray. Hot key for File Access: This will allow you to choose a hot key to automatically open up File Access Manager if hit. i.e- F1-F12.
Set Security Preferences Pause drive when program closes: This will PAUSE the driver installed by File Access Manager to allow access to exclusive files upon closing the application.
Set Log Preferences Enable log file: This will enable File Access Manager to create a log file as it opens up file(s), requested by the “allowed applications”. Log file location: This allows you to dictate where you want File Access Manager to create and store the log files. (only available if “enable log files” is selected. Log file max size: This allows you to dictate the MAXIMUM file size of the log file that File Access Manager creates. If the log file exceeds the dictated size, the log file will get deleted.
Start . By selecting this optionyou will START the driver installed by File Access Manager to allow access to exclusive files
Views
This allows you to select different display options for you to view files in File Access Manager. They include title, lists and details. |
